Transaction d63ae537e12d05fa69509f8a81f27de35dc54a21f888aee8b909028760272ac4
1 Input
1 Output
-
d63ae537e12d05fa69509f8a81f27de35dc54a21f888aee8b909028760272ac4:0
- value
- 1461705
- script pubkey
- OP_0 OP_PUSHBYTES_20 88ebcca30916533d906fe289804794388cc21762
- address
- bc1q3r4uegcfzefnmyr0u2ycq3u58zxvy9mzdx8h09